Bike Size and Fit



When picking a bicycle for your kid, the relevance of bike size and fit can not be overemphasized. An appropriately sized bike boosts safety and security and comfort, allowing your child to develop their riding skills successfully. A bike that is also large might bring about instability, while one that is too small can impede growth and restrict motion.


A lot of makers supply sizing graphes that associate these dimensions with wheel dimensions, commonly varying from 12 inches for toddlers to 24 inches for older children. When your kid sits on the saddle, they ought to be able to touch the ground with their toes, ensuring they can quit securely.

Weight Considerations



Weight factors to consider play a crucial function in selecting the ideal bike for your kid. Generally, a bike must weigh no more than 30% of the youngster's body weight.


When examining bike weight, products are significant. Light weight aluminum structures are typically preferred over steel because of their lighter weight and equivalent sturdiness. Additionally, the elements of the bicycle, including brakes, wheels, and gears, can add to the general weight. Deciding for a bike with simpler, high-quality parts can decrease weight while preserving efficiency.


Another critical aspect is the bike's intended usage. A somewhat larger bike might supply security if the youngster will be riding on diverse surface or participating in off-road activities. Nonetheless, for general use and casual riding, prioritizing a lightweight option will certainly enhance the overall experience.


Safety And Security Features



Many security features are vital to take into consideration when picking a bicycle for your child, as they considerably enhance defense throughout rides. Make certain that the bike is outfitted with reliable brakes. Both hand brakes and coaster brakes need to be easy and receptive for kids to utilize, allowing for reliable quiting power.

Additionally, the presence of reflectors and lights is crucial for visibility, especially if your youngster will certainly be riding in low-light conditions. Look for bikes that consist of reflectors on the front, rear, and wheels, as well as an incorporated front lights and taillight where possible.

Sturdiness and Materials



Toughness and materials are critical aspects to take into consideration in a kid's bike, as they directly influence the bike's life expectancy and efficiency. When choosing a bike for your child, it is necessary to select versions constructed from high-grade materials that can withstand the roughness of day-to-day use.


Light weight aluminum frameworks are often favored for their lightweight residential or commercial properties and resistance to corrosion and corrosion, making them suitable for youngsters that may leave their bikes outdoors. Steel frameworks, while larger, provide exceptional toughness and can absorb shocks properly, giving a smoother experience over rough terrains.


Additionally, the top quality of parts such as the handlebars, seat, and wheels is important. Try to find enhanced parts that can withstand damage, especially in areas susceptible you could try these out to effect. Tires with robust tread patterns add to security and long life, guaranteeing a risk-free riding experience.


Finally, consider the finish of the bike. A resilient paint or powder-coated surface not only improves visual appeal but also safeguards versus scrapes and environmental elements. Buying a bike made from high-quality materials ensures your youngster will certainly enjoy a safe and reliable riding experience for years to come.


Gearing and Brakes



When selecting a bike for your kid, understanding the tailoring and brake system is crucial for making certain a pleasurable and secure riding experience. For younger children, single-speed bikes are frequently optimal, offering simplicity and ease of usage.


Equally essential is the brake system. There are 2 major kinds: edge brakes and disc brakes. Rim brakes prevail in youngster bikes and are usually enough for laid-back riding. Nevertheless, disc brakes offer premium stopping power and efficiency in wet conditions, making them a rewarding consideration for even more adventurous riders.
